The Recipe How-To

“Satisfy your sweet and spicy cravings with this divine dessert.”

Now, let’s get down to business- the making of this delicious White Chocolate Ginger Cheesecake. This recipe has three main components – the biscuit base, the filling, and the toppings. Let’s get started:

Biscuit Base:

Ingredients:

  • 300g ginger biscuits
  • 150g unsalted butter, melted

Instructions:

  1. Start by crushing your biscuits into fine crumbs. You can either use a food processor or put them in a plastic bag and bash them with a rolling pin.
  2. Mix the biscuit crumbs with melted butter until evenly combined.
  3. Pour the mixture into an 8 inch (20cm) greased cake tin and press firmly onto the base of the tin.
  4. Bake in a preheated oven at 180°C for about 10 minutes until lightly golden.

Filling:

Ingredients:

  • 300g white chocolate
  • 750g cream cheese
  • 250ml soured cream
  • 4 free-range eggs
  • 200g caster s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 tsp ground ginger
  • 100g crystallized ginger, chopped

Instructions:

  1. Melt the white chocolate using a double boiler/ heatproof bowl over simmering water or in a microwave for about a minute or until completely melted. Stir occasionally to prevent burning.
  2. Beat the cream cheese and sugar together in a mixing bowl until smooth and creamy.
  3. Gradually add the eggs one by one while still whisking.
  4. Fold in the remaining ingredients which include soured cream, vanilla extract, ground ginger, crystallized ginger and melted white chocolate into the mixture until combined.
  5. Pour the filling over the cooled biscuit base and smooth it out gently.

Tips for Perfect Results

“Put a smile on your loved ones’ faces with this delicious dessert after a special dinner.”

To achieve perfect results with this white chocolate ginger cheesecake recipe, here are some helpful tips to keep in mind.

Firstly, be sure to melt the white chocolate and unsalted butter together in a heat-proof bowl over simmering water. Avoid using a microwave or direct heat as this can easily burn the chocolate.

Next, ensure that all ingredients, particularly the cream cheese and eggs, are at room temperature before beginning. This will help the ingredients combine more easily and produce a smoother texture.

When mixing the filling, use an electric mixer on low speed to avoid adding too much air into the batter. Overmixing can lead to cracks on your cheesecake surface during baking.

When it comes to baking, use a water bath to prevent the cheesecake from cracking as well. Simply wrap the bottom of your springform tin in foil and place it in a roasting pan. Pour boiling water into the pan until it reaches halfway up the sides of the tin.

Finally, allow your cheesecake to cool completely before slicing and serving. This allows for the flavors and texture to set properly.

Ingredients

CRUST If you must

  • 13 ounces gingersnaps
  • 2 tablespoons sugar
  • 1 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 3 1/2 ounces unsalted butter, melted and cooled

FILLING

  • 1 lb white chocolate
  • 32 ounces cream cheese
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 4 large eggs, room temp
  • 1 large egg yolk, room temp
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la
  • 1 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 1 cup crystallized ginger, minced (chop with chef’s knife with sugar so it doesn’t stick. Avoid cuisinart)

Instructions

  • Preheat 325 dergee oven.
  • Nine inch springform buttered, wrapped in foil.
  • Combine all crust ingredients in food processor, pulse until ground.
  • Press into bottom of pan and up the sides if you can’t controll yourself.
  • Melt chocolate.
  • Beat cheese until fluffy,add sugar and beat well, add egg one at a time.
  • Beat in vanilla, ground ginger and then white chocolate.
  • Fold in crystalized ginger.
  • Bake in water bath until done.
  • chill overnight.
